Day.png);">
Apprendre


Vous êtes
nouveau sur
Oniromancie?

Visite guidée
du site


Découvrir
RPG Maker

RM 95
RM 2000/2003
RM XP
RM VX/VX Ace
RM MV/MZ

Apprendre
RPG Maker

Tutoriels
Guides
Making-of

Dans le
Forum

Section Entraide

Tutos: Checklist de la composition (...) / Sorties: Dread Mac Farlane - episode 8 / Sorties: Dread Mac Farlane - episode 7 / Jeux: Ce qui vit Dessous / News: Quoi de neuf sur Oniromancie (...) / Chat

Bienvenue
visiteur !




publicité RPG Maker!

Statistiques

Liste des
membres


Contact

Mentions légales

431 connectés actuellement

29385433 visiteurs
depuis l'ouverture

5 visiteurs
aujourd'hui



Barre de séparation

Partenaires

Indiexpo

Akademiya RPG Maker

Blog Alioune Fall

Fairy Tail Constellations

RPG Fusion

Lumen

Zarok

Hellsoft

RPG Maker - La Communauté

Tous nos partenaires

Devenir
partenaire



Enlever le cadre dans le titre

Enlève l'opacité du windowskin sur l'écran titre.

Script pour RPG Maker XP
Ecrit par Inconnu
Publié par R-adr-P-ien-G (lui envoyer un message privé)
Signaler un script cassé

❤ 0

Code provenant de RTGames, ne l'enregistrez pas, faîtes un copier/coller direct.

Concrètement, enlève l'opacité de la boîte de choix au niveau de l'écran titre dans Scene_Title, soit :

Portion de code : Tout sélectionner

1
2
@command_window.opacity = 0
@command_window.back_opacity = 0


en-dessous de la ligne 288

Portion de code : Tout sélectionner

1
@command_window.y = 288



Version autonome (à placer au-dessus de Main) :

Portion de code : Tout sélectionner

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
#==============================================================================
# ■ Scene_Title : Redéfinition
# ■ Placer en dessous de Scene_Title avec le même nom
# ■ Traduction des commentaires par lalilo...
#==============================================================================
 
class Scene_Title
  #--------------------------------------------------------------------------
  # ● Traitement principal : Redéfinition
  #--------------------------------------------------------------------------
  def main
    # Chargement de la base de données
    $data_actors        = load_data("Data/Actors.rxdata")
    $data_classes      = load_data("Data/Classes.rxdata")
    $data_skills        = load_data("Data/Skills.rxdata")
    $data_items        = load_data("Data/Items.rxdata")
    $data_weapons      = load_data("Data/Weapons.rxdata")
    $data_armors        = load_data("Data/Armors.rxdata")
    $data_enemies      = load_data("Data/Enemies.rxdata")
    $data_troops        = load_data("Data/Troops.rxdata")
    $data_states        = load_data("Data/States.rxdata")
    $data_animations    = load_data("Data/Animations.rxdata")
    $data_tilesets      = load_data("Data/Tilesets.rxdata")
    $data_common_events = load_data("Data/CommonEvents.rxdata")
    $data_system        = load_data("Data/System.rxdata")
    $data_mapinfos      = load_data("Data/MapInfos.rxdata")
    # Élaboration de l'objet système
    $game_system = Game_System.new
    # Élaboration des graphiques du titre
    @sprite = Sprite.new
    @sprite.bitmap = RPG::Cache.title($data_system.title_name)
    # Élaboration de la fenêtre de commande
    s1 = "Commencer"
    s2 = "Continuer"
    s3 = "Quitter"
    @command_window = Window_Command.new(212, [s1, s2, s3])
    @command_window.opacity = 0
    @command_window.back_opacity = 0
    @command_window.contents_opacity = 192
    @command_window.x = 320 - @command_window.width / 2
    @command_window.y = 288
    # Décision efficace continue
    # Vous inspectez si le dossier de sauvegarde existe même à un
    # Si validité si @continue_enabled vrai, inadmissibilité qu'il rend faux
    @continue_enabled = false
    for i in 0..3
      if FileTest.exist?("Save#{i+1}.rxdata")
        @continue_enabled = true
      end
    end
    # Quand continuer est efficace, le curseur est ajusté sur continuer
    # Dans le cas inadmissible, les lettres de continuer sont faites en couleur gris
    if @continue_enabled
      @command_window.index = 1
    else
      @command_window.disable_item(1)
    end
    # Exécution du titre BGM
    $game_system.bgm_play($data_system.title_bgm)
    # Arrêt de l'exécution de ME et de BGS
    Audio.me_stop
    Audio.bgs_stop
    # Exécution de transition
    Graphics.transition
    # Boucle principale
    loop do
      # Remplacer l'image de jeu
      Graphics.update
      # Mise à jour de l'information de l'entrée
      Input.update
      # Renouvellement de frame
      update
      # Quand l'image change, discontinuant la boucle
      if $scene != self
        break
      end
    end
    # Préparation de transition
    Graphics.freeze
    # Libérer la fenêtre de commande
    @command_window.dispose
    # Libérer les graphiques du titre
    @sprite.bitmap.dispose
    @sprite.dispose
  end
end






DarkMaker - posté le 14/01/2009 à 23:02:48 (8 messages postés)

❤ 0

Se script marche uniquement sur XP sur VX (je ne sais pas sur xp)
il suffit de rajouter ceci au script Scene_Title:

Portion de code : Tout sélectionner

1
2
3
4
 
@command_window.opacity = 0
@command_window.back_opacity = 0
 


en-dessous de :
@command_window.y = 288
qui est ligne 288
Et si tu te lance dans le RGSS1 alors bonne continuation !


R-adr-P-ien-G - posté le 15/01/2009 à 07:11:41 (60 messages postés)

❤ 0

Jeune maker

ok javais pas vraiment remarquer :F

J'ai une signature moi ?


Silouk - posté le 16/01/2009 à 22:15:28 (474 messages postés)

❤ 0

Ca peut être utile ! :) Cela fait plus de place pour le fond d'écran titre.


R-adr-P-ien-G - posté le 17/01/2009 à 19:04:21 (60 messages postés)

❤ 0

Jeune maker

Oui c'est vrai :D

J'ai une signature moi ?


Casualblues - posté le 07/04/2009 à 22:50:40 (40 messages postés)

❤ 0

J'aime beaucoup ce script
Non en fait il est vraiment bien ce script, juste pas toujours compatible. mais sinon ça va ! Bravo !:D

Quoique ce que dit DarkMarker est plus simple !:ange

~Fufufuuuuufufuuuuuh ~ Mysterious Whistle

Suite à de nombreux abus, le post en invités a été désactivé. Veuillez vous inscrire si vous souhaitez participer à la conversation.

Haut de page

Merci de ne pas reproduire le contenu de ce site sans autorisation.
Contacter l'équipe - Mentions légales

Plan du site

Communauté: Accueil | Forum | Chat | Commentaires | News | Flash-news | Screen de la semaine | Sorties | Tests | Gaming-Live | Interviews | Galerie | OST | Blogs | Recherche
Apprendre: Visite guidée | RPG Maker 95 | RPG Maker 2003 | RPG Maker XP | RPG Maker VX | RPG Maker MV | Tutoriels | Guides | Making-of
Télécharger: Programmes | Scripts/Plugins | Ressources graphiques / sonores | Packs de ressources | Midis | Eléments séparés | Sprites
Jeux: Au hasard | Notre sélection | Sélection des membres | Tous les jeux | Jeux complets | Le cimetière | RPG Maker 95 | RPG Maker 2000 | RPG Maker 2003 | RPG Maker XP | RPG Maker VX | RPG Maker VX Ace | RPG Maker MV | Autres | Proposer
Ressources RPG Maker 2000/2003: Chipsets | Charsets | Panoramas | Backdrops | Facesets | Battle anims | Battle charsets | Monstres | Systems | Templates
Ressources RPG Maker XP: Tilesets | Autotiles | Characters | Battlers | Window skins | Icônes | Transitions | Fogs | Templates
Ressources RPG Maker VX: Tilesets | Charsets | Facesets | Systèmes
Ressources RPG Maker MV: Tilesets | Characters | Faces | Systèmes | Title | Battlebacks | Animations | SV/Ennemis
Archives: Palmarès | L'Annuaire | Livre d'or | Le Wiki | Divers